Because your roof is consistently exposed to the outside elements, it means your roof is will diminish gradually. The rate at which it deteriorates will be dependent on a variety of factors. These include; the quality of the original components used along with the craftsmanship, the amount of abuse it will have to take from the weather, how well the roof is maintained and the style of the roof. Most roofing contractors will estimate around 20 years for a well-built and well-kept roof, but obviously that can never be promised because of the above variables. Our suggestion is to consistently keep your roof well maintained and get regular checkups to make sure it lasts as long as possible.
You should not ever pressure wash your roof, as you run the risk of taking off any protective materials that have been added to provide protection from the weather. On top of that, you really should try to stay away from chlorine-based bleach cleaning products as they can easily also cut down the lifespan of your roof. When you talk to your roof cleaning professional, tell them to use an EPA-approved algaecide/fungicide to wash your roof. That will eliminate the unsightly algae and discoloration without damaging the tile or shingles.

Matthews is a town in southeastern Mecklenburg County, North Carolina. It is a suburb of Charlotte. The population was 27,198 according to the 2010 Census.
In the early 19th century, the early settlement that would become Matthews was unofficially named Stumptown for the copious amount of tree stumps left from making way for cotton farms. The community’s name later changed to Fullwood, named after appointed area postmaster John Miles Fullwood. The establishment of a sawmill and the cotton and timber industry helped Fullwood change into a town. Prior to the first train arriving on December 15, 1874, Fullwood acted as a stagecoach stop between Charlotte and Monroe. The town was incorporated into a municipal corporation in 1879 and was renamed to Matthews for Edward Watson Matthews, a prominent resident, and director of the Central Carolina Railroad, which would later become known as the Seaboard Air Line Railroad.[4][5]
The Seaboard Air Line Fell Into Seaboard On July 1, 1967. Seaboard Then Merged With Chessie System To Create CSX (Chessie Seaboard X)
Products also can be found in a variety of styles and colors. Metal roofs with strong sheathing control sound from rain, hail and bad weather condition just as well as any other roof product. Metal roof can likewise assist eliminate ice damming at the eaves. And in wildfire-prone locations, metal roofing helps safeguard buildings from fire, ought to burning embers arrive on the roofing.

Wood shakes deal a natural look with a great deal of character. Since of variations in color, width, thickness, and cut of the wood, no two shake roofs will ever look the very same. Wood provides some energy benefits, too. It assists to insulate the attic, and it allows your house to breathe, distributing air through the little openings under the felt rows on which wood shingles are laid.
Mold, rot and pests can become a problem. The life-cycle cost of a shake roofing might be high, and old shakes can’t be recycled. The majority of wood shakes are unrated by fire security codes. Lots of usage wipe or spray-on fire retardants, which provide less protection and are only reliable for a couple of years.
Installing wood shakes is more complex than roof with composite shingles, and the quality of the finished roofing system depends on the experience of the specialist, as well as the quality of the shakes used. The finest shakes originated from the heartwood of large, old cedar trees, which are tough to discover.

Concrete tiles are made from extruded concrete that is colored. Traditional roofing tiles are made from clay. Concrete and clay tile roofing systems are durable, visually appealing, and low in maintenance. They likewise supply energy cost savings and are environmentally friendly. Although product and setup costs are higher for concrete and clay tile roofings, when evaluated on a price-versus-performance basis, they might out-perform other roofing products.
In fact, because of its severe sturdiness, durability and safety, roofing system tile is the most prevalent roof product worldwide. Evaluated over centuries, roofing system tile can successfully stand up to the most severe climate condition consisting of hail, high wind, earthquakes, scorching heat, and harsh freeze-thaw cycles. Concrete and clay roofing system tiles also have unconditional Class A fire ratings, which means that, when installed according to constructing code, roof tile is non-combustible and preserves that quality throughout its lifetime.
Because the ultimate longevity of a tile roofing system also depends upon the quality of the sub-roof, roofing system tile manufacturers are likewise working to improve flashings and other elements of the underlayment system. Under normal situations, appropriately installed tile roofs are virtually maintenance-free. Unlike other roof products, roofing tiles really become stronger over time.

Concrete and clay tile roof are likewise energy-efficient, assisting to preserve habitable interior temperatures (in both cold and warm environments) at a lower expense than other roof. Because of the thermal capability of roof tiles and the aerated air space that their positioning on the roofing system surface area produces, a tile roof can decrease air-conditioning costs in hotter climates, and produce more continuous temperature levels in colder areas, which decreases possible ice build-up.
They are produced without using chemical preservatives, and do not deplete minimal natural resources. Single-ply membranes are versatile sheets of intensified artificial products that are made in a factory. There are three kinds of membranes: thermosets, thermoplastics, and modified bitumens. These products offer strength, versatility, and long-lasting sturdiness.
They are naturally versatile, utilized in a range of accessory systems, and compounded for lasting resilience and leak-proof stability for years of roof life. Thermoset membranes are intensified from rubber polymers. The most frequently used polymer is EPDM (often described as “rubber roofing”). Thermoset membranes make effective roof materials since they can withstand the potentially destructive effects of sunlight and most typical chemicals normally found on roofs.
Thermoplastic membranes are based on plastic polymers. The most common thermoplastic is PVC (polyvinyl chloride) which has actually been made versatile through the inclusion of particular components called plasticizers. Thermoplastic membranes are determined by seams that are formed using either heat or chemical welding. These seams are as strong or stronger than the membrane itself.
Modified bitumen membranes are hybrids that integrate the high-tech solution and pre-fabrication benefits of single-ply with a few of the standard installation strategies used in built-up roof. These materials are factory-fabricated layers of asphalt, “modified” utilizing a rubber or plastic component for increased flexibility, and combined with support for extra strength and stability.
The type of modifier utilized might determine the approach of sheet setup. Some are mopped down using hot asphalt, and some usage torches to melt the asphalt so that it flows onto the substrate. The seams are sealed by the exact same method.
